Wetin be apple cider vinegar?
Since di word “vinegar” dey derived from di French “sour wine”, e no dey surprising say apple cider vinegar na di product of one second fermentation of apples. Dem go grind appleswit yeast to turn dia sugar to alcohol, den, during di second fermentation, di alcohol go turn to acetic acid by bacteria wey dem dey call acetobacter.
Acetic acid dey make up about 5-6% of apple cider vinegar (ACV). From one nutritional point of view, VCP contain very few carbohydrates, small trace elements including potassium, and approximately three calories per tablespoon (15 ml).
Wetin apple cider vinegar dey do?
Dem dey take am as supplement before meals, some believe say apple cider vinegar fit help reduce appetite, manage blood sugar levels, and promote fat burning. However, most of dis evidence na based on animal studies and na little quality research support dis actions for humans.
How dem dey follow di apple cider vinegar diet?
Recent studies wey sabi pipo carry out wit use of one daily dose of 15ml of apple cider vinegar wey dem dilute for 250ml of water. Dis dose dey consistent wit most ACV dieters, wey recommend to take 1 to 2 tablespoons (15 to 30 ml) of VCP per day, mixed wit water. Some choose to spread di dose ova 24 hour period and many dey recommend to drink am diluted directly bifor meals.
Wen pesin wan begin take apple cider vinegar, many suggest to start wit smaller amount, like 1 teaspoon (5 ml) wey dem dilute for water, to gauge your tolerance to di vinegar. Di diet involve make pesin include apple cider vinegar as supplement to meals, but no restrictions on wetin you chop during di diet.
How to take apple cider vinegar?
Di diet suggest to take VCP wit water as drink, but e fit also dey mixed wit oil to make salad dressing – otherwise, you fit use am to make chutney or pickles.
Wetin be di evidence of di effectiveness of di apple cider vinegar diet?
One March 2024 study, wey bin test daily doses of apple cider vinegar on 120 overweight or obese pipo find say, taking three daily doses over one period of four to twelve weeks bin result for weight loss significantly.
E also get some interesting studies wey fit support dis more recent research wey evaluate di effects of vinegar on di diet. For example, animal studies don suggest say di acetic acid for vinegar fit promote fat loss and burning, reduce fat storage, manage appetite, and improve blood sugar and insulin response. Some human studies fit support dis hypothesis, wit 2009 study wey show say modest weight loss dey associated wit lower blood lipid (triglyceride) levels for pipo wey dey consume vinegar dan for those wey no consume am.
Dis data suggest say no be just ACV, but potentially oda vinegars wey dey high for acetic acid, wey fit provide dis benefits.
I go fit lose weight on di apple cider vinegar diet?
Di recent study suggest say weight loss dey possible for overweight or obese pipo. Indeed, ogbonge reductions for weight, body mass index, body fat percentage and waist and hip circumferences dey noted. However, longer-term, larger-scale clinical studies wit minimal bias dey needed before dem fit reach definitive conclusions, and no research on long-term weight loss maintenance. .

Apple cider vinegar diet dey healthy? One nutritionist point of view…
Wen you put am for different diet, apple cider vinegar fit get potential health benefits, including to help manage blood sugar and insulin levels, especially afta hydrate-based meal of carbon. Di March 2024 study bin note say, to add to weight loss, improvement for blood sugar, triglycerides and cholesterol levels dey. However, no expect dis to be di solution to your weight loss problems – healthy, balanced diet combine wit physical activity remain di solution to weight loss wey go last.
Wen e come to apple cider vinegar, less na more. To consume more dan di recommended dose of 1 to 2 tablespoons fit dey harmful, interact wit prescribed medications, or cause dental damage as e go dey wear out di tooth enamel. To take am undiluted and all at once, apple cider vinegar fit cause nausea and burning sensation for mouth or esophagus.
Who no suppose follow the Apple Cider Vinegar Diet?
Although occasional use dey safe for most of us, some number of pipo no suppose follow di apple cider vinegar diet. Dis include pipo wit chronic condition pipo sabi as gastroparesis, wia movement of food from di stomach to di small intestine dey delayed. For dis pipo, apple cider vinegar fit likely make dia symptoms worse.
E also worth to remember say VCP dey very acidic and therefore fit irritate di throat if you drink am often and for large quantities. For pipo wit histamine intolerance, fermented foods, including vinegar, fit make dia symptoms worse. Apple cider vinegar fit also interact wit certain supplements and medications, including diuretics and insulin.
Consult your doctor or health care professional before you begin any new regimen, especially if you dey under 18, elderly, get pre-existing condition, or dey take medications including diuretics , insulin or medicines to control blood sugar.
